## Partner SFTP Drop — Marlowe Freight

Files land nightly between 02:00–03:30 UTC in the inbound drop. Watcher job `marlowe-ingest` picks them up; if nothing arrives by 04:00, the Quillhook alert fires. Do NOT re-request files from Marlowe before checking the quarantine folder — malformed headers get parked there silently. Retries are safe; ingest is idempotent on file checksum. Rotation of the drop credentials is quarterly, owned by platform. Full escalation steps and contacts are on the runbook page.

dashboard of taduf-tahof = https://confluence.tolvaqlabs.internal/browse/browse/display/f01240ca

Ticket: Offline mode sync vault locked — TrailMark field-survey app. After last night's deploy, surveyors at the Kestrel Flats site can't decrypt cached plots; the local vault rejects the session key and refuses re-pairing. This blocks offline edits entirely until the vault is reopened. Workaround attempts (restart, cache clear) failed. You'll need to unlock the recovery vault on the sync node and re-issue device keys from there. The vault accepts the standing recovery passphrase, which is included below for on-call use.

unlock words, kawig-bawef: belax-sorir-druax-ulaiel-wenael-belael

# The Quillbank monolith's user module is being split into a
# standalone service called Ledgerkey. During the transition,
# plugins must call the new service directly; the old in-process
# hooks are frozen and will be removed next quarter.
# Session lookups, profile reads, and role checks all route
# through Ledgerkey now. Expect slightly higher latency on cold
# starts. Rate limits apply per plugin.
# Your plugin authenticates with a shared secret defined in this file.
# It goes on the line immediately below this comment:

sealed setting: COURIER_KEY29=170ad45524657711572101e080d15